diff options
author | Matt Turner <mattst88@gmail.com> | 2024-07-22 14:58:47 -0400 |
---|---|---|
committer | Matt Turner <mattst88@gmail.com> | 2024-08-05 15:43:00 -0400 |
commit | ac343c8fdc7c59698d208b0ac2aafb0eb71bb46f (patch) | |
tree | c774b899222ae66a23f9cd25ad2d63e84a87b748 /mesa-run | |
parent | 8d9cf1a5844c74810ee06d53cc3ea4052dc561f9 (diff) |
mesa-run: Use `meson devenv`
Diffstat (limited to 'mesa-run')
-rwxr-xr-x | mesa-run | 12 |
1 files changed, 1 insertions, 11 deletions
@@ -11,7 +11,6 @@ prefix="${builddir}"/install machine=$(uname -m) case "$machine" in x86_64) - vk_icd="intel_icd.${machine}.json" vulkan_drivers=intel gallium_drivers=iris tools=drm-shim,intel @@ -21,7 +20,6 @@ x86_64) ) ;; aarch64|arm*) - vk_icd="freedreno_icd.${machine}.json" vulkan_drivers=freedreno gallium_drivers=freedreno tools=drm-shim,freedreno @@ -68,12 +66,4 @@ build) ;; esac -if ! command -v jq &> /dev/null; then - die "jq needs to be installed" -fi - -libdir=$(jq -r '.[] | select(.name == "libdir").value' "${builddir}"/meson-info/intro-buildoptions.json) -export LD_LIBRARY_PATH="${prefix}/${libdir}:${LD_LIBRARY_PATH}" -export LIBGL_DRIVERS_PATH="${prefix}/${libdir}"/dri -export VK_ICD_FILENAMES="${prefix}"/share/vulkan/icd.d/"${vk_icd}" -LD_PRELOAD="${GCC_ASAN_PRELOAD}" exec "$@" +LD_PRELOAD="${GCC_ASAN_PRELOAD}" exec meson devenv -C "${builddir}" -w "${PWD}" "$@" |